This foundational role emerges not only in finance and physics but also in the design of complex systems where independent trials generate emergent order\u2014much like the millions of digital interactions shaping Aviamasters Xmas each year.<\/p>\n<h2>Binomial Distributions and the Birth of Exponential Patterns<\/h2>\n<p>Discrete stochastic processes, such as binomial trials, reveal how \\( e \\) quietly underpins probabilistic convergence. The binomial probability formula, \\( P(X=k) = \\binom{n}{k} p^k (1-p)^{n-k} \\), describes outcomes of \\( n \\) independent events with success probability \\( p \\). As \\( n \\) grows large and \\( p \\) small but \\( np = \\lambda \\) stabilizes, the binomial distribution converges to the Poisson distribution\u2014whose shape is deeply tied to \\( e^{-\\lambda} \\).
